5. Recovery of Plaintext:
Once you have
# 1. Calculate the totient (phi)
phi = (p - 1) * (q - 1)
# 2. Calculate the private key d (modular inverse of e mod phi)
d = gmpy2.invert(e, phi)
# 3. Decrypt the ciphertext c
m = pow(c, d, n)
# 4. Convert the large integer m back to readable text
# We use 'big' because RSA integers are stored in big-endian format
byte_length = (m.bit_length() + 7) // 8
flag = m.to_bytes(byte_length, 'big').decode()
print(f"Decrypted Flag: {flag}")
